Recording of my session on the Global Azure Bootcamp Austria 2020.
GraphQL is a query language designed to build applications by providing an intuitive and flexible syntax and system for describing their data requirements and interactions. GitHub utilizes GraphQL as API because it offers greater adaptability for the developers. The choice to absolutely produce the data that a client needs is an incredible advantage over sending numerous REST calls to get the same. In this session you will learn you will learn some GraphQL basics and how to host Apollo server on an Azure Function.

Someone asked what are common pitfalls when you get started with GraphQL. I mentioned performance and caching, but additionally designing an API as a graph is at the beginning challenging and requires some rethinking.

Sample code at GitHub

Thanks a lot to the organizers who changed the event quickly into an online event because of covid-19 and for the very well preparation. Thx!